Abstract
The hydrothermal crystallization of hierarchical Bi2WO6 nanostructures has been monitored with in situ energy-dispersive X-ray diffraction (EDXRD). The kinetic data analysis according to the Avrami-Erofe'ev model suggests that the formation of nanostructured Bi2WO6 is diffusion controlled with Avrami exponents around 0.5 and that the growth mechanism is temperature independent in the interval from 150 to 180 degrees C. Furthermore, the reaction kinetics and the crystal structure of the resulting hydrothermal products depend on the pH value of the Bi(NO3)(3)center dot 5H(2)O/K2WO4 hydrothermal system.
